Thanks to everyone who chimed in with the question of the line:

'There's no place like home'

My collegue was doing something for her class in marketing where they were supposed to find an ad that just didn't do what it was supposed to. Something that fell flat. She had an ad/poster thing for the National Geographic channel. It was something about a series on natural disasters. It said:

Volcanos
Tsunamis
Tornados

There's no place like home.

I think the problem was the line had been translated into Danish -- the only thing that made me go Oh! was the ruby slippers above the text. It just doesn't ring the same kind of bell in my language LOL. It didn't really work until I realized it was most probably an ad translated from English... and then the bells rang like you wouldn't believe it XD
